Poon's has been part of London's food story for over fifty years - from Bill and Cecilia's Michelin-starred Covent Garden restaurant in the 1980s to Amy Poon's stunning new permanent home in the New Wing of Somerset House.

Already one of the most talked-about openings in the city, Grace Dent called it "sweet, confident, feminine, ballsy and glamorous." The xkybehq Infatuation named it "the most graceful and..."
